Basaltic magma has less silica, and hence it is less viscous. It flows over a long-distance causing seafloor spreading but not volcanic ... WebSep 20, 2024 · compression. The squeezing force at a convergent boundary is called compression. The pulling force at a divergent boundary is called tension. The side-by-side dragging force at transform boundaries is called shear. These forces result in distinct landforms at plate boundaries.

WebJun 30, 2024 · Unlike divergent and convergent boundaries, at transform boundaries no new crust is created, and there is no subduction (or sandwiching) of plates.
